A dryer vent aids in drying the dryer’s interior by removing moisture, and part of the warm air it produces also includes tiny bits of lint off clothing. Lint could build up within the venting with age and obstruct it. Solution: Inspect and cleanse the vents to avoid clogs. WebScorch marks on fabrics often appear after leaving a hot iron unattended or scorched iron plates that cause a stain on the fabric. Other causes of scorch marks could be a cigarette burn or too much lint in your dryer.
